Output 18d220d32559289707b5f71baf5ce9b698c0668fcad60ed5e1157bb9b9ef97c6:1

value
93154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a385583255110793a18b14a34af0b551607991 OP_EQUAL
address
3BxbVf9Nqk7vbnybN2m6jjpCVuMz3ghA6n
transaction
18d220d32559289707b5f71baf5ce9b698c0668fcad60ed5e1157bb9b9ef97c6
confirmations
406073
spent
true